I do not know Canadian laws and rules and bureaucracy, but most of the states here have some kind of "transport for repair" permit. If a vehicle has a issue that it would not pass that states inspection (Like a missing front fender and headlight in my case), you could get one of these permits that would allow you to operate the vehicle long enough to get it to a repair facility.

As I said, I do not know laws for Transport Canada, but it can't hurt to ask.
